Google is currently testing a new feature for Android tablets that will allow users to open apps in resizable windows, much like on a PC. 

This feature will enable you to drag and adjust the size of apps, and in some cases, even open multiple instances of the same app.

Right now, most apps on Android tablets open in full-screen mode. However, with this new feature, apps can be opened in a window, with familiar buttons in the top-right corner, just like on a desktop computer. 

You’ll be able to maximize or close the app from there. There’s also a new taskbar at the bottom of the screen, making it easier to switch between different apps.

To activate this feature, you simply need to hold your finger at the top of the app window. 

If you’re using a keyboard with your tablet, you can use the shortcut Windows/Command/Search + Ctrl + down arrow to switch to windowed mode. 

To exit window mode, either close all open apps or drag the window to the top of the screen.

For now, this exciting new feature is only available on the latest developer version of Android 15, and only on Pixel tablets. 

There’s no word yet on when it will roll out to other devices or when it will be fully released.
